God Will Meet You There

God will meet you there
In that secret place of prayer.
He’ll reach down from on high
And hear the humble cry.

You will encounter Him
And from the weight of sin
You will be freed at last!
The Savior’s love is vast!

Take that daring leap.
Your life will be complete
When in that special place
You meet God face-to-face!

-- Charity Lacroix, girl, 15 yrs old

Worth My Praise


Lord, always keep me humble
In all you have me do.
Help me not to stumble
But give the praise You’re due.

I’d rather wait till later
To reap my sure reward.
For You are always greater,
My everlasting Lord!

The good that people see
Is only found in You.
And all the flesh is me.
The honor I refuse.

When I think of who You are,
You’re always worth my praise,
That You would even go so far
As to use this jar of clay.

-- CV, girl, age 15

I'll Follow You


My future, my life, You hold in Your hands.
You are in control of all of my plans.
When I’m in the center of Your grand design,
A peace that surpasses all knowledge I find.

Through doors that You’ve opened You tell me to go.
But if I’m to stay, Lord, You let me know.
You guide me along and do not mislead.
Wherever I go, You have met every need.

Some days can be hectic, with no time to spare,
Yet throughout it all, You’re always right there.
And whatever it is that You want me to do,
Because You know best, then I’ll follow You.

-- CV, girl, age 15

The Hunter and the Hunted

The devil’s on a mission
There is a goal he’s set.
He wants the lives of Christians
Who aren’t committed yet.

All along the way
He does the best he can
To turn each one away
From Christ, the Son of Man.

Sometimes he will succeed
In bringing one to hell.
But when God intercedes,
His plans do not go well.

He sees the doors shut tight
Within a true believer.
They’re clothed in holy light,
Revolting the deceiver.

They’re armored with the Cross
And following God’s ways.
Jesus is their Boss,
So satan turns away.

For someone else he’ll search.
He’s in a raging mood.
He hates the Lord, the Church.
He’s hunting down his food.

Charity Lacroix, girl, age 15  

Scriptural basis for the poem:
"Be of sober spirit, be on the alert. Your adversary, the devil, prowls around like a roaring lion, seeking someone to devour." (1Pe 5:8)

"Submit therefore to God. Resist the devil and he will flee from you." (Jas 4:7)

God Will Help Us

God is strength.
God is power.
He can help us
Any hour!

Any time He is there;
Any time or anywhere;
He will help us overcome.
Any time, He will come.

God is good, God is mighty.
He's more powerful than the lightning.

God can help us.
He is strong.
He can help us.
Short or long.

-- C.R., boy, age 8

Scriptures:
"God is our refuge and strength, A very present help in trouble." (Psa 46:1)

"Hear, O LORD, and be gracious to me; O LORD, be my helper." (Psa 30:10)

"Behold, God is my helper; The Lord is the sustainer of my soul." (Psa 54:4)

"For he will deliver the needy when he cries for help, The afflicted also, and him who has no helper." (Psa 72:12)

"I will ask the Father, and He will give you another Helper, that He may be with you forever; that is the Spirit of truth, whom the world cannot receive, because it does not see Him or know Him, but you know Him because He abides with you and will be in you." (Joh 14:16-17)

Nothing Will Separate


 No trouble can be found
Where you are on your own,
Left bleeding on the ground,
Forsaken and alone.

The hardships that you face,
The dangers or the sword,
No time, nor depth, nor space
Can keep you from the Lord.

Throughout the fiery flames,
The testing of the heart,
His love will still remain
And grace will not depart.

Do not fear any man,
Nor what may lie ahead,
For you are in God’s hand,
So fear the Judge instead.

Charity Lacroix, girl, age 14   

Scriptural basis for the poem:
"What shall we then say to these things? If God be for us, who can be against us? He that spared not his own Son, but delivered him up for us all, how shall he not with him also freely give us all things? Who shall lay any thing to the charge of God's elect? It is God that justifieth. Who is he that condemneth? It is Christ that died, yea rather, that is risen again, who is even at the right hand of God, who also maketh intercession for us. Who shall separate us from the love of Christ? shall tribulation, or distress, or persecution, or famine, or nakedness, or peril, or sword? As it is written, For thy sake we are killed all the day long; we are accounted as sheep for the slaughter. Nay, in all these things we are more than conquerors through him that loved us. For I am persuaded, that neither death, nor life, nor angels, nor principalities, nor powers, nor things present, nor things to come, Nor height, nor depth, nor any other creature, shall be able to separate us from the love of God, which is in Christ Jesus our Lord."  (Rom 8:31-39, NASB)

"I say to you, My friends, do not be afraid of those who kill the body and after that have no more that they can do. But I will warn you whom to fear: fear the One who, after He has killed, has authority to cast into hell; yes, I tell you, fear Him!" (Luk 12:4-5)

Judgment of Babylon


God is judging Babylon,
For she is filled with pride.
Instead of turning back to Him,
His Word she has defied.

In her hand she holds the cup
Of her adulteries.
This Mother of the Prostitutes
Has made the Lord displeased.

Her mouth is filled with wickedness
And darkness is her cloak.
Her heart has turned to other gods.
The Lover is provoked.

God simply has no other choice,
So judgment falls like rain.
Because she learns not through His words,
Then she must learn through pain.

This land’s no longer of the free.
With sin it is defiled.
Now God must judge America,
The great, rebellious child.

-- Charity Lacroix, girl, age 14    

My daughter, Charity Lacroix, wrote this poem on March 25, 2013.  It's meant to be Part One to another poem she wrote previously, called America, Turn Back to God.  She is of the opinion that America is the Babylon of Revelation 17 and 18, which God is now going to judge.

My daughter is not the only one who believes this.  There are many who do, like Texe Marrs, which he writes about on his website.

Another man named, Dumitru Duduman, who was a Romanian evangelist that immigrated to America, received an angelic visitation in which he was told America is Babylon. In his book, Dreams and Visions From God, he answered the question, "Why did God name America Mystery Babylon?"  He wrote the answer he was given by God in 1984:  "Tell them, because all the nations of the world immigrated to America with their own gods and were not stopped. Encouraged by the freedom here, the wickedness began to increase.  Later on, even though America was established as a Christian nation, the American people began to follow the strange gods that the immigrants had brought in, and also turned their backs on the God who had built and prospered this country." You can also read a transcript of the angelic visitation in which he was told how America would fall.

Whether Texe Marrs and Dumitru Duduman have really heard from God will soon become evident to all.
